A Week Exploring Thrissur and Palakkad on a Shoestring Budget

Saturday December 23: Begin your journey by flying into Kochi International Airport and then taking a bus or train to Thrissur. Once you arrive, start your day by visiting the iconic Vadakkunnathan Temple, a Hindu temple dedicated to Lord Shiva. Explore the intricate architecture and peaceful surroundings. In the afternoon, head to the Thrissur Zoo and Museum, home to a variety of animals and exhibits. Wrap up the day by strolling through the vibrant streets of Thrissur and trying local street food.

  • Vadakkunnathan Temple: Estimated cost - FREE,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Thrissur Zoo and Museum: Estimated cost - INR 10,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Exploring Thrissur Streets: Estimated cost - Varies, Time spent - Flexible
Sunday December 24: Explore Thrissur Cultural Sites

Start your day by visiting the Kerala Kalamandalam, a renowned center for Indian performing arts. Enjoy traditional dance and music performances showcasing Kerala's rich cultural heritage. In the afternoon, visit the Archaeological Museum to learn more about the history and heritage of Thrissur. End the day with a visit to the Athirapally Waterfalls, known for their scenic beauty and lush green surroundings.

  • Kerala Kalamandalam: Estimated cost - INR 50,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Archaeological Museum: Estimated cost - INR 20,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Athirapally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 15,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Monday December 25: Journey to Palakkad

Take a bus or train to Palakkad, known as the "Gateway of Kerala." Start your day by exploring the Palakkad Fort, a well-preserved ancient fort with beautiful architecture and a history dating back to the 18th century.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in nature by visiting the Malampuzha Dam and Gardens, a picturesque spot offering boating, garden walks, and a ropeway ride. End the day with a visit to the Thiruvalathoor Bhagavathy Temple, a sacred Hindu shrine.

  • Palakkad Fort: Estimated cost - INR 10,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Malampuzha Dam and Gardens: Estimated cost - INR 30,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Thiruvalathoor Bhagavathy Temple: Estimated cost - FREE,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Tuesday December 26: Discover Silent Valley National Park

Embark on a day trip to Silent Valley National Park, a biodiversity hotspot teeming with lush forests, wildlife, and stunning vistas. Take a guided tour to explore the park's trails, observing rare species of flora and fauna along the way. Enjoy a peaceful picnic amidst nature and capture unforgettable photographs.

  • Silent Valley National Park: Estimated cost - INR 60, Time spent - Full day
Wednesday December 27: Explore Palakkad Town

Start your day by visiting the Jainmedu Temple, an ancient Jain temple known for its intricate carvings and peaceful atmosphere. In the afternoon, explore the Kalpathy Heritage Village, a charming settlement with traditional Kerala houses and the famous Kalpathy Sree Viswanathaswamy Temple. Don't miss the chance to try Palakkad's local delicacies at one of the authentic eateries.

  • Jainmedu Temple: Estimated cost - FREE,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Kalpathy Heritage Village and Temple: Estimated cost - FREE,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Thursday December 28: Visit Silent Rocks and Dhoni Waterfalls

Today, embark on an adventure to Silent Rocks, a hidden gem offering breathtaking views of the Western Ghats. Explore the rock formations and enjoy the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, head to the Dhoni Waterfalls, known for their cascading beauty. Take a refreshing dip in the pool below the falls and embrace the tranquility of nature.

  • Silent Rocks: Estimated cost - FREE,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Dhoni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 20 (entrance fee), Time spent - 2-3 hours
Friday December 29: Relax and Depart

Take this day to relax and reflect on your memorable journey in Thrissur and Palakkad. You can visit local markets for some last-minute shopping or enjoy a leisurely stroll in a nearby park. In the evening, catch your return flight from Kochi International Airport.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Off the beaten path, consider visiting the Puzhakkal River and its adjoining forest, known for its scenic beauty and tranquility. Another local favorite is the Deer Park in Malampuzha, where you can spot a variety of deer species in a natural habitat. Both these attractions offer a peaceful retreat into nature without breaking the bank.
